/external/clang/lib/CodeGen/ |
CGExprComplex.cpp | 560 Value *ResRl = Builder.CreateMul(Op.LHS.first, Op.RHS.first, "mul.rl"); 561 Value *ResRr = Builder.CreateMul(Op.LHS.second, Op.RHS.second,"mul.rr"); 564 Value *ResIl = Builder.CreateMul(Op.LHS.second, Op.RHS.first, "mul.il"); 565 Value *ResIr = Builder.CreateMul(Op.LHS.first, Op.RHS.second, "mul.ir"); 595 llvm::Value *Tmp1 = Builder.CreateMul(LHSr, RHSr); // a*c 596 llvm::Value *Tmp2 = Builder.CreateMul(LHSi, RHSi); // b*d 599 llvm::Value *Tmp4 = Builder.CreateMul(RHSr, RHSr); // c*c 600 llvm::Value *Tmp5 = Builder.CreateMul(RHSi, RHSi); // d*d 603 llvm::Value *Tmp7 = Builder.CreateMul(LHSi, RHSr); // b*c 604 llvm::Value *Tmp8 = Builder.CreateMul(LHSr, RHSi); // a* [all...] |
CGExpr.cpp | 434 llvm::Value *A0 = Builder.CreateMul(Builder.CreateXor(Low, High), KMul); 436 llvm::Value *B0 = Builder.CreateMul(Builder.CreateXor(High, A1), KMul); 438 return Builder.CreateMul(B1, KMul); [all...] |
CGExprScalar.cpp | 411 return Builder.CreateMul(Ops.LHS, Ops.RHS, "mul"); 426 return Builder.CreateMul(Ops.LHS, Ops.RHS, "mul"); [all...] |
CGExprCXX.cpp | 766 numElements = CGF.Builder.CreateMul(numElements, asmV); [all...] |
CGAtomic.cpp | 410 Val1Scalar = Builder.CreateMul(Val1Scalar, CGM.getSize(PointeeIncAmt)); [all...] |
/external/llvm/include/llvm/Transforms/Utils/ |
Local.h | 231 Op = Builder->CreateMul(Op, ConstantInt::get(IntPtrTy, Size),
|
/frameworks/compile/libbcc/lib/Renderscript/ |
RSForEachExpand.cpp | 398 OutOffset = Builder.CreateMul(OutOffset, OutStep); 404 InOffset = Builder.CreateMul(InOffset, InStep); 551 OutOffset = Builder.CreateMul(OutOffset, OutStep); 557 InOffset = Builder.CreateMul(InOffset, InStep);
|
/external/llvm/include/llvm/Support/ |
NoFolder.h | 72 Instruction *CreateMul(Constant *LHS, Constant *RHS, 74 BinaryOperator *BO = BinaryOperator::CreateMul(LHS, RHS);
|
ConstantFolder.h | 48 Constant *CreateMul(Constant *LHS, Constant *RHS,
|
TargetFolder.h | 64 Constant *CreateMul(Constant *LHS, Constant *RHS,
|
/external/llvm/lib/Transforms/InstCombine/ |
InstCombineAddSub.cpp | 1023 return BinaryOperator::CreateMul(RHS, AddOne(C2)); 1028 return BinaryOperator::CreateMul(X, ConstantExpr::getAdd(C1, C2)); 1033 return BinaryOperator::CreateMul(LHS, AddOne(C2)); [all...] |
InstCombineMulDivRem.cpp | 139 return BinaryOperator::CreateMul(NewOp, ConstantExpr::getShl(C1, C2)); 165 Value *Add = Builder->CreateMul(X, CI); 166 return BinaryOperator::CreateAdd(Add, Builder->CreateMul(C1, CI)); 187 BinaryOperator::CreateMul(Sub, 208 return BinaryOperator::CreateMul(Op0v, Op1v); [all...] |
InstCombineShifts.cpp | 348 return BinaryOperator::CreateMul(BO->getOperand(0),
|
InstCombineCasts.cpp | 132 Amt = AllocaBuilder.CreateMul(Amt, NumElements); [all...] |
/external/llvm/unittests/ExecutionEngine/JIT/ |
JITEventListenerTestCommon.h | 111 Arg = Builder.CreateMul(Arg, Builder.CreateAdd(Arg, one));
|
/external/llvm/lib/Transforms/Scalar/ |
Reassociate.cpp | 323 BinaryOperator::CreateMul(Neg->getOperand(1), Cst, "",Neg); [all...] |
CodeGenPrepare.cpp | [all...] |
/art/compiler/llvm/ |
ir_builder.h | 234 ::llvm::Value* block_offset = CreateMul(bs, count);
|
/external/llvm/include/llvm/MC/ |
MCExpr.h | 440 static const MCBinaryExpr *CreateMul(const MCExpr *LHS, const MCExpr *RHS,
|
/external/llvm/lib/Analysis/ |
MemoryBuiltins.cpp | 669 Size = Builder.CreateMul(Size, ArraySize); 692 Value *Size = Builder.CreateMul(FirstArg, SecondArg);
|
/external/llvm/include/llvm/IR/ |
IRBuilder.h | 617 Value *CreateMul(Value *LHS, Value *RHS, const Twine &Name = "", 621 return Insert(Folder.CreateMul(LC, RC), Name); 626 return CreateMul(LHS, RHS, Name, false, true); 629 return CreateMul(LHS, RHS, Name, true, false); [all...] |
/external/llvm/lib/Transforms/Utils/ |
IntegerDivision.cpp | 75 Value *Product = Builder.CreateMul(Divisor, Quotient);
|
/external/llvm/lib/Target/NVPTX/ |
NVPTXAsmPrinter.cpp | 237 return MCBinaryExpr::CreateMul(LHS, RHS, Ctx); [all...] |
/external/llvm/lib/IR/ |
Instructions.cpp | 405 AllocSize = BinaryOperator::CreateMul(ArraySize, AllocSize, 408 AllocSize = BinaryOperator::CreateMul(ArraySize, AllocSize, [all...] |
/art/compiler/dex/portable/ |
mir_to_gbc.cc | 376 case kOpMul: res = irb_->CreateMul(src1, src2); break; [all...] |